They are a self-slabber that grossly overgrades coins and sells them themselves (i.e. obvious conflict of interest). Biggest scam on ebay.
overgrade 3-4 ticks. the way biggest problem is authentication. i read a thread on ebay that someone bought SGS gold (bad idea), and it was fake. 3-4 ticks overgraded and DO NOT BUY KEY DATES, commons only!!
and, SGS is a fine example of.......................caveat emptor.
